How a Small Financial Institution Spurred Progress in the South

by Former Governor William Winter

Nearly 20 years ago, several of us in the Mid South decided that in order to tackle the problems of poverty in the Mississippi Delta, we needed something entirely new.

Government solutions alone were not working, subject as they are to the vagaries of political whim, and the turnover inherent in elective democracy. Unemployment, bad health outcomes, and low educational achievement had proved persistent.
